Effect of Sleep on Metabolic process



When it concerns weight management, comprehending the effect of sleep on metabolism is essential. Sleep plays a considerable duty in regulating your body's metabolism, which is the procedure of transforming food into power. Throughout sleep, your body services fixing cells, manufacturing hormonal agents, and managing various physical functions. Absence of sleep can interrupt these procedures, leading to discrepancies in metabolic process.

Study has actually revealed that poor sleep can impact your metabolic process by altering hormone degrees connected to cravings and appetite. Especially, not enough sleep can bring about a boost in ghrelin, a hormone that promotes cravings, and a decline in leptin, a hormonal agent that reduces appetite. This hormonal imbalance can result in overeating and desires for high-calorie foods, which can undermine your weight-loss goals.

To enhance your metabolic process and sustain your weight reduction journey, prioritize getting sufficient quality sleep each evening. Aim for 7-9 hours of sleep to aid regulate your metabolic rate, regulate your appetite, and enhance your total health and wellness. By dealing with your rest, you can improve your body's ability to melt calories effectively and attain sustainable weight loss.

Duty of Sleep in Hormone Policy



As you dive much deeper right into the link in between sleep and fat burning, it becomes obvious that the role of sleep in hormone law is an essential aspect to take into consideration. Rest plays an essential role in the guideline of different hormonal agents that affect hunger and metabolic rate. One essential hormonal agent influenced by sleep is leptin, which aids control energy equilibrium by inhibiting hunger. Lack of rest can cause lower degrees of leptin, making you really feel hungrier and potentially causing overindulging.

In addition, sleep deprival can interfere with the production of ghrelin, another hormonal agent that boosts appetite. When ghrelin degrees are elevated due to bad rest, you might experience stronger cravings for high-calorie foods.



Additionally, not enough sleep can affect insulin sensitivity, which is crucial for controling blood sugar degrees. Poor sleep routines can result in insulin resistance, enhancing the threat of weight gain and type 2 diabetic issues.

Influence of Sleep on Food Cravings



Sleep plays a considerable function in influencing your food cravings. When you do not obtain sufficient rest, your body experiences disruptions in the hormonal agents that manage appetite and fullness. This imbalance can cause a rise in ghrelin, the hormone that stimulates appetite, while decreasing leptin, the hormonal agent that signals volume. Consequently, you may find yourself yearning high-calorie and sugary foods to provide a fast energy increase.

Furthermore, absence of rest can influence the brain's benefit centers, making unhealthy foods much more attractive and more challenging to withstand.

Study has actually shown that sleep-deprived individuals often tend to choose foods that are greater in fat and calories contrasted to when they're well-rested. This can sabotage your fat burning efforts and bring about unwanted weight gain over time.
